Understanding LED Technology
Before exploring the advantages of patio LED lighting, it’s essential to grasp the technology behind LEDs. Light Emitting Diodes (LEDs) are semiconductor devices that emit light when an electric current passes through them. This technology has revolutionized the lighting industry due to its energy efficiency and long lifespan. The development of LEDs has also led to innovations in color rendering and brightness control, allowing for a wide range of applications from residential to commercial settings.
Energy Efficiency
One of the most significant advantages of LED lighting is its energy efficiency. Compared to traditional incandescent bulbs, LEDs consume significantly less electricity to produce the same amount of light. This efficiency not only reduces energy bills but also minimizes the environmental impact, making it a sustainable choice for outdoor lighting. Additionally, many LED fixtures are designed to be dimmable, providing users with the flexibility to adjust brightness according to their needs, further enhancing energy savings during lower usage times.
Longevity of LED Lights
LEDs are known for their impressive lifespan, often lasting up to 25,000 hours or more. This longevity is a result of their robust construction and lower heat output. Unlike incandescent bulbs, which generate a considerable amount of heat, LEDs operate at cooler temperatures, reducing the risk of burnout and extending their operational life. Furthermore, the durability of LEDs makes them resistant to shock and vibration, which is particularly beneficial for outdoor environments where weather conditions can be unpredictable. This resilience ensures that your patio lighting remains functional and aesthetically pleasing for years to come, even in the face of harsh elements.

Installation Considerations for Patio LED Lighting
While the benefits of patio LED lighting are clear, proper installation is paramount to ensure optimal performance and longevity. Several factors need to be considered during the installation process.
Choosing the Right Fixtures
Selecting the appropriate fixtures for outdoor use is crucial. Outdoor LED lights should be weatherproof and designed to withstand various environmental conditions. Options include wall-mounted fixtures, string lights, and in-ground lights, each serving different purposes and aesthetics. Additionally, consider the color temperature of the LEDs; warmer tones can create a cozy atmosphere, while cooler tones may enhance visibility and modern appeal. The style of the fixtures should also complement the overall design of your patio, whether it leans towards rustic charm or sleek contemporary lines.
Optimal Placement
The placement of LED lights can significantly impact their effectiveness. For instance, lights should be installed to avoid glare while ensuring adequate illumination of key areas. Strategically placing lights along pathways, near seating areas, and around trees or landscaping can create a balanced and inviting atmosphere. Furthermore, think about the height at which lights are mounted; lower fixtures can provide a more intimate setting, while higher placements can cast broader light across the space. Incorporating dimmable options or smart lighting systems can also allow for flexibility in ambiance, adapting to different occasions and moods.
Electrical Considerations
When installing patio LED lighting, it’s essential to adhere to electrical codes and safety standards. This includes using appropriate wiring and ensuring that all connections are secure and protected from moisture. In some cases, hiring a professional electrician may be advisable to guarantee a safe and compliant installation. Additionally, consider integrating timers or motion sensors into your lighting system. These features not only enhance convenience but also improve energy efficiency by ensuring lights are only on when needed. Planning for future maintenance is also wise; using fixtures that allow for easy bulb replacement can save time and effort down the line.
Maintenance Practices for Longevity
To maximize the lifespan of patio LED lighting, regular maintenance is necessary. While LEDs require less upkeep than traditional lighting, a few simple practices can ensure they continue to perform optimally.
Regular Cleaning
Outdoor lights are exposed to dust, dirt, and weather elements, which can diminish their brightness over time. Regularly cleaning the fixtures with a soft cloth and mild detergent can help maintain their appearance and functionality. It’s also important to check for any debris that may obstruct the light output. Additionally, during the cleaning process, consider using a gentle brush to remove any stubborn grime or spider webs that may have accumulated around the fixtures. This not only enhances the aesthetic appeal but also ensures that the lights operate at their full capacity, providing a warm and inviting atmosphere for outdoor gatherings.
Inspecting Connections
Periodic inspections of electrical connections and wiring are vital for safety and performance. Loose or corroded connections can lead to flickering lights or complete failures. Ensuring that all connections are tight and free from corrosion can prevent potential issues down the line. It’s also wise to inspect the power source and extension cords, if used, for any signs of wear or damage. Over time, exposure to the elements can cause insulation to degrade, leading to potential hazards. Regular checks can help catch these problems early, ensuring a safe and reliable lighting system.
